Drainage Pump Installation in Boston, MA

Drainage pump installation services involve setting up specialized equipment designed to move excess water away from residential properties, preventing flooding and water damage. These services are commonly requested for projects such as installing sump pumps in basements, managing water runoff in yards, or upgrading existing drainage systems to improve overall water management. Property owners typically want to understand the different types of drainage pumps available, how they work, and what factors influence the best choice for their specific property, including the size of the area, water flow needs, and potential water sources.

Before requesting drainage pump installation, homeowners often seek guidance on the suitability of different pump models, the placement requirements, and how the system integrates with existing drainage infrastructure. It’s also helpful to consider the property's topography and drainage patterns, as these can affect the effectiveness of the pump system. Proper installation ensures reliable operation during heavy rain or flooding events, helping to protect the property’s foundation and prevent water-related issues.

Drainage Pump Installation Questions

What is a drainage pump used for? A drainage pump removes excess water from basements, crawl spaces, or low-lying areas to prevent flooding and water damage.

When should property owners consider installing a drainage pump? Installation is recommended when there is frequent water accumulation or poor drainage in specific areas of the property.

What types of drainage pumps are available? Common options include sump pumps, sewage ejector pumps, and effluent pumps, each suited for different drainage needs.

How does a drainage pump installation benefit property maintenance? Proper installation helps protect the property from water damage, reduces mold growth, and maintains a dry, safe environment.
